Spate of arson attacks across borough
A VW Golf was set on fire on Creswick Road, East Herringthorpe, at 12.45am this morning (Monday).
A crew from Maltby Fire Station attended the blaze and left the scene just after 1am.

Hide AdArsonists also struck on Sunday at 5.15am on Roger Street, Thornhill.
A South Yorkshire Fire and Rescue spokeswoman said household rubbish near to some allotments was set alight and a crew from Rotherham station brought the fire under control within 30 minutes.
Another deliberate fire was started in a derelict building on College Lane, Rotherham, at 8.40pm on Saturday.
Crews from Rotherham and Aston station attended and left the scene at 9.10pm.
A crew from Cudworth Station attended an arson attack on Bolton Road, Wath, at 7.15pm on Saturday after some grassland was torched.
Firefighters left the scene at 8.20pm.
